Dog Biscuit Booths to Benefit Feral Cats at Big Sunday

This coming Sunday, May 1st, animal lovers will be gathering together at Big Sunday, one of the biggest annual volunteer events in southern California.

That’s when thousands of people from Southern California, of all ages and all backgrounds, work together to lend a hand to nonprofits, schools and other agencies that need their help. Last year on Big Sunday Weekend, 50,000 volunteers turned out at more than 500 different projects from San Diego to Solvang, making Big Sunday Weekend one of the largest regional community service events in America.

Big Sunday takes place at hundreds of different sites throughout the Southland, from downtown L.A. to the Westside, from the San Fernando Valley to the San Gabriel Valley, from Orange County to the Inland Empire to Ventura County. There are opportunities for every passion, talent, skill and age. Projects are scheduled throughout the weekend, and can last anywhere from one hour to two full days. Big Sunday Weekend also includes special events such as art shows, sports days, yard sales and blood drives.

This year, one of the special activities will be benefitting FixNation!

Volunteers can sign up to host a dog biscuit booth to sell dog biscuits to benefit one of five local animal non profit organization: FixNation, Clinico, Bark Avenue Foundation, Seal Beach Animal Care Center and the Southern California Labrador Retriever Rescue.

As a host, you run your own booth and staff it with your friends, family, co-workers… whoever you want as volunteers. Big Sunday will provide some supplies, including very cute and delicious (so we’ve heard!) dog biscuits, signage and more.

You can choose ANY location and time to hold your booth. The only requirement is that the booth be open for a minimum of two hours on either May 1st or May 2nd.
